Satilla Regional Library System presents the Spring Art Reception with the featured artist Mr. Harvey Williams, Jr. Come out and see all of the new photographs and talk with Mr. Williams on Saturday, March 5, 2022, from 3-5 p.m. in the Douglas Library. All of the artwork in the reception will be distributed throughout all of the branches of the Satilla Regional Library to be displayed for all to enjoy.
